CreeTar Posted June 28, 2010 Author Share Posted June 28, 2010 it seems the problem was that the script itself needs Admin status while the SciTE runs without Admin priviledge and therefore cannot catch the STDOUT or whatever ^^ it works if i start SciTE as Admin...
